Le Marume Co., Ltd., commissioned by Ojiya City, Niigata Prefecture, will launch a demonstration project from April 2026 to create a "work-friendly environment" centered on women's empowerment, aiming to solve the labor shortage in regional companies. The project will involve interviews and analysis for five companies in the city, visualizing organizational issues and proposing improvements to promote sustainable human resource utilization and organizational development.
